Sound:
Impact Insulation Class (IIC) The method is designed to measure the change in impact sound transmission of a floor-ceiling assembly in a controlled laboratory environment. ASTM E2179-03.
IIC = 20
Sound Transmission Class. (STC) The sound-insulating property of a partition element is expressed in terms of the sound transmission loss. (Stand alone product – no ceiling or wall assembly) ASTM E90-04, ASTM E413-04.
STC = 15
Noise Reduction Coefficient (NRC) A single number rating obtained by taking the arithmetic average of the absorption coefficients at specified frequencies, rounded to the nearest 0.05.
NRC = 0.50
Sound Absorption Average (SAA) A single number rating obtained by taking the arithmetic average of the one-third octave bands at specified frequencies, rounded to the nearest 0.01.
SAA = 0.49
